Originally released in 1938. Trade Winds is a romance/comedy film. directed by Tay Garnett.

Starring Fredric March, Joan Bennett, and Ralph Bellamy

Synopsis

After committing a murder, Kay assumes a new identity and boards a ship. But, Kay is unaware that Sam, a skirt chasing detective, is following her and must outwit him to escape imprisonment.
